Vijay, Tamil film star, has for long been wildly popular with fans but in these last years social media turned him from only a movie person into, a real political force. With millions following online and a very active fan base, his political path shows how digital platforms are changing politics in India today.

From film person to political leader

Vijay, called Thalapathy by many, announced his party Tamilaga Vettri Kazhagam (TVK) in 2024. Actors joining politics is not new in Tamil Nadu yet his rise is different because networks built his political image much before he formally entered politics.

Sites like X, Instagram, YouTube and Facebook let him speak to young voters directly. His speeches, film lines, social posts and public appearances often went viral. Fan clubs across Tamil Nadu also became like small campaign groups online sharing videos posters and notes every day.

A strong fan base became a digital army

Fans were always loyal but social media gave them a louder voice. Thousands of fan run pages highlighted his charity work, school support programs and social drives. That made Vijay seem not only an actor but someone who cares about people.

When Vijay released a film, hashtags linked to him would trend nationally in hours. Analysts say this online power later helped him collect public backing for political aims. Fan clubs also set up blood donation camps, food drives and welfare events which they pushed heavily online.

This online presence helped him stay close to young voters especially first time voters who spend lots of time on social platforms.

Political ideas through cinema

Many of Vijay’s movies carried social and political themes. Films like Sarkar, Master and Mersal contained lines that criticised corruption, bad governance and inequality. These bits often became viral clips and kicked off political chats among audiences.

Fans shared those movie moments as proof that he had leadership qualities and a feel for real issues. Little by little cinema and politics began mixing in his public image.

A main reason for his rise is the support of young people. Social media made him seem modern easy to reach and not like the usual politicians. Short clips quick remarks and casual public moments spread fast online and drew big reaction

Instead of old style campaigning based on rallies and TV his supporters used memes reels hashtags and online trends to talk about him every day

Experts say this digital route helped him reach city voters and college groups more than many longer-established parties

Obstacles ahead for Vijay

Despite massive online fame turning that energy into real election wins will be difficult. Tamil Nadu politics is dominated by big parties like the DMK and AIADMK. Vijay will need a solid ground team experienced leaders and clear policies to compete seriously

Still his social media influence already made him one of the most talked about political names in the state

Conclusion

Social networks changed how famous people move into politics and Vijay is a clear example in India right now. His path shows online fame fan activity and digital campaigning can shape political influence these days Whether he becomes a lasting political leader or not his rise shows social media plays a major role in Indian politics.
